NEW EDITION, REVISED AND UPDATED In this new edition of the bestselling classic, Charles Manz doesn’t look to Jesus’s teachings to support preconceived theories of how a manager should lead but approaches the New Testament with an open mind to see what insights it reveals for today’s business world. What he finds are powerful lessons that will inspire you—no matter what your religious background—to maintain integrity, live on a higher plane, and ultimately achieve your personal and professional goals. The third edition is updated throughout and includes several new examples and a self-assessment chapter designed to encourage self-examination and personal reflection. Remarkably contemporary and welcoming to all readers, this book will challenge you to evaluate your own leadership style and to consider time-tested spiritual wisdom that can make you more enlightened and more effective.

In Jesus, CEO, Jones compares Jesus to a CEO who turned a disorganized "staff" of twelve into a thriving, long-lasting enterprise.With the twenty-fifth anniversary edition of Jesus, CEO, Jones revises and updates her original modernized guidance, ensuring that everyone can continue to apply the ancient wisdom pulled straight from the Bible. Filled with fresh, practical, and profound advice, Jesus, CEO helps managers motivate their teams and themselves. Jones divides this advice into three sections: strength of self-mastery, strength of actions, and strength of relationships.
